Preference for brown baking parchment
Our partner supplier Wrapfilm has completed market research which shows customers have a preference for brown baking parchment instead of bleached white. So we’re changing our baking parchment rolls from white to brown at no extra cost!
The positives of moving to a brown unbleached baking parchment are:
- Brown paper evokes perceptions of tradition and home-made products
- Matches current trend in brown muffin cases and paper in coffee shops
- Responds to customer interest in untreated, natural products
Our supplier says that the brown parchment rolls are better for the environment because:
- No bleach is used
- Uses less energy to manufacture
- Produced only from natural raw materials
- Made from FSC certified paper from sustained forests
